Catalytic CO oxidation processes under dilute oxygen conditions are key industrial and environmental processes. CeO_2-supported Pd and Pd–Cu catalysts (Pd/CeO_2 and Pd–Cu/CeO_2) were prepared by impre...gnation, and the effect of Cu addition on the catalytic properties of CO oxidation was investigated under CO/O2 stoichiometric conditions. The activity of Pd/CeO_2 was superior to that of Pd/TiO2 and Pd/Al_2O_3 at low temperatures. The Cu addition to Pd/CeO_2 with a Cu/Pd molar ratio of approximately 1–5 enhanced the CO oxidation activity. Small PdO particles were distributed over the CeO_2 surfaces, and Cu addition decreased the size of the Pd particles on the CeO_2 and increased the fraction of highly reactive Pd sites. As the Cu/Pd mole fraction in the Pd–Cu/CeO_2 catalyst increased to 10, the PdO on CeO_2 agglomerated significantly, and the CO oxidation activity decreased.続きを見る
